Basic Information

Item Details
Product Name 4,8-Epoxy-1,3-Dioxolo[4,5-D][1,2]Oxazepine (9Ci)
CAS No. 154729-35-8
Molecular Formula C7H5NO4
Molecular Weight 167.12 g/mol
Synonyms 4,8-Epoxy-1,3-dioxolo[4,5-d][1,2]oxazepine; 1,3-Dioxolo[4,5-d][1,2]oxazepine, 4,8-epoxy-; [1,2]Oxazepine, 4,8-epoxy-1,3-dioxolo[4,5-d]-; (9CI); 154729-35-8 (CAS).

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at controlled room temperature (15-25°C). Keep away from strong oxidizing agents and incompatible materials. For long-term storage, consider inert atmosphere conditions to maintain optimal stability.
